The moment someone declares, “Its a boy!” or “Its a girl!” the biological make up of that child isnt the only thing established - a process of gendering begins and continues throughout that persons life. One aspect of that process is how we learn to communicate. Based on the premise that males and females learn different ways to relate, this program investigates how communication styles fall onto a continuum of what society deems as masculine and feminine and what it means to deviate from the norm
